Taking the lantern from the backseat of the car, you confidently declare your intent to conquer the ancient halls of Mirewood Manor.  You’ll climb that spire where the Lady Fletch hung from her broken neck and light the lantern as proof.  With the cheers and shocked gasps of your friends lending you renewed strength, you stride past the towering wrought iron gates and down the gravel driveway.

The tale of Mirewood Manor was well known throughout town well before your birth.  While it may have had some roots in factual, worldly events, time has a way of twisting and perverting the truth.  By the time you heard it on your first camping trip all those years ago, several decades had passed, but your friends held their collective breath right along with you.

For the past several weeks, I've been experimenting.  For as long as I can remember, Google has been my go-to search engine.  The only other one that I can remember before that was Ask Jeeves (now reduced to the Ask atrocity) and before that was AOL (needing to go the way of the dodo).  In 2009, Microsoft announced its own search engine, Bing.  Ever since, the engine has been panned by the general public and critics alike.  In my own personal experience, it's looked upon as highly as Windows Vista and Windows 8.  Not ever having had used the engine myself, I thought it was time to give it a go.
